Harleston, on the border between Norfolk and Suffolk, is situated in the picturesque Waveney Valley, not far from the Suffolk Heritage Coast and surrounded by countless scenic towns and villages. This welcoming community features historic inns, unique shops, delicious eateries, cultural attractions like a museum and gallery, and a thriving weekly market. Participate in angling and birdwatching, peruse antiques at auctions, or simply take a stroll in the countryside from your doorstep. There are countless places to visit within a day's drive, such as the Sandringham Estate, the Aviation and Steam Train Museums, castles, cathedrals, breweries, vineyards, and the world-famous Norfolk Broads. Large numbers of tourists visit nearby Bungay every year to see its many historic sites, including the ruins of Bigod's Castle, the Buttercross, the Spring Garden Market, the Summer Antiques Fair, and the Christmas Market. Beccles, at the head of the Broads, is a bustling market town, and Southwold, on the fabulous Suffolk coast, is home to a magical amber shop.

Oil central heating. Electric oven, electric hob, microwave, fridge, freezer, washer/dryer and dishwasher. TV with Freeview. Fuel and power inc. in rent. Bed linen and towels inc. in rent. Off-road parking. Private garden with garden furniture, patio, orchard, swing set. Two well-behaved dogs welcome but sorry, no smoking. Shop 1 mile, pub 1.3 miles and River Waveney 0.2 miles. Note: This property does not have WiFi. Note: Fishing lake directly behind the property, guests can buy a day ticket for £6 a day to fish at the lake
